PRAEGER WORLD OF ART (FREDERICK A. PRAEGER, INC.)
Series Note: This series comes in two formats, each with its own series name variant:
(1) Praeger World of Art Paperbacks: paperback format
(2) Praeger World of Art Series: hardback format

This series has been described as being "remarkable for quality of writing (scholarly but always lucid) and lavishness of illustration" (Source: Edward Barry, "Bottles, hot dogs map zany 'pop' art laneways", in: Chicago Tribune, 17 October 1965, p. 2.)

Many of the Praeger World of Art titles were also published in The World of Art Library by the publisher Thames & Hudson, London, U.K.
